1 // SPDX-License-Identifier: GPL-2.0+
2 /*
3  * Copyright (C) 2017 Marek Vasut <marek.vasut@gmail.com>
4  *
5  * Renesas RCar USB HOST xHCI Controller
6  */
7 
8 #include <common.h>
9 #include <clk.h>
10 #include <dm.h>
11 #include <fdtdec.h>
12 #include <log.h>
13 #include <malloc.h>
14 #include <usb.h>
15 #include <wait_bit.h>
16 #include <dm/device_compat.h>
17 #include <linux/bitops.h>
18 
19 #include <usb/xhci.h>
20 #include "xhci-rcar-r8a779x_usb3_v3.h"
21 
22 /* Register Offset */
23 #define RCAR_USB3_DL_CTRL	0x250	/* FW Download Control & Status */
24 #define RCAR_USB3_FW_DATA0	0x258	/* FW Data0 */
25 
26 /* Register Settings */
27 /* FW Download Control & Status */
28 #define RCAR_USB3_DL_CTRL_ENABLE	BIT(0)
29 #define RCAR_USB3_DL_CTRL_FW_SUCCESS	BIT(4)
30 #define RCAR_USB3_DL_CTRL_FW_SET_DATA0	BIT(8)
31 
32 struct rcar_xhci_plat {
33 	fdt_addr_t	hcd_base;
34 	struct clk	clk;
35 };
36 
37 /**
38  * Contains pointers to register base addresses
39  * for the usb controller.
40  */
41 struct rcar_xhci {
42 	struct xhci_ctrl ctrl;	/* Needs to come first in this struct! */
43 	struct usb_plat usb_plat;
44 	struct xhci_hccr *hcd;
45 };
46 
xhci_rcar_download_fw(struct rcar_xhci * ctx,const u32 * fw_data,const size_t fw_array_size)47 static int xhci_rcar_download_fw(struct rcar_xhci *ctx, const u32 *fw_data,
48 				 const size_t fw_array_size)
49 {
50 	void __iomem *regs = (void __iomem *)ctx->hcd;
51 	int i, ret;
52 
53 	/* Download R-Car USB3.0 firmware */
54 	setbits_le32(regs + RCAR_USB3_DL_CTRL, RCAR_USB3_DL_CTRL_ENABLE);
55 
56 	for (i = 0; i < fw_array_size; i++) {
57 		writel(fw_data[i], regs + RCAR_USB3_FW_DATA0);
58 		setbits_le32(regs + RCAR_USB3_DL_CTRL,
59 			     RCAR_USB3_DL_CTRL_FW_SET_DATA0);
60 
61 		ret = wait_for_bit_le32(regs + RCAR_USB3_DL_CTRL,
62 					RCAR_USB3_DL_CTRL_FW_SET_DATA0, false,
63 					10, false);
64 		if (ret)
65 			break;
66 	}
67 
68 	clrbits_le32(regs + RCAR_USB3_DL_CTRL, RCAR_USB3_DL_CTRL_ENABLE);
69 
70 	ret = wait_for_bit_le32(regs + RCAR_USB3_DL_CTRL,
71 				RCAR_USB3_DL_CTRL_FW_SUCCESS, true,
72 				10, false);
73 
74 	return ret;
75 }
76 
xhci_rcar_probe(struct udevice * dev)77 static int xhci_rcar_probe(struct udevice *dev)
78 {
79 	struct rcar_xhci_plat *plat = dev_get_plat(dev);
80 	struct rcar_xhci *ctx = dev_get_priv(dev);
81 	struct xhci_hcor *hcor;
82 	int len, ret;
83 
84 	ret = clk_get_by_index(dev, 0, &plat->clk);
85 	if (ret < 0) {
86 		dev_err(dev, "Failed to get USB3 clock\n");
87 		return ret;
88 	}
89 
90 	ret = clk_enable(&plat->clk);
91 	if (ret) {
92 		dev_err(dev, "Failed to enable USB3 clock\n");
93 		goto err_clk;
94 	}
95 
96 	ctx->hcd = (struct xhci_hccr *)plat->hcd_base;
97 	len = HC_LENGTH(xhci_readl(&ctx->hcd->cr_capbase));
98 	hcor = (struct xhci_hcor *)((uintptr_t)ctx->hcd + len);
99 
100 	ret = xhci_rcar_download_fw(ctx, firmware_r8a779x_usb3_v3,
101 				    ARRAY_SIZE(firmware_r8a779x_usb3_v3));
102 	if (ret) {
103 		dev_err(dev, "Failed to download firmware\n");
104 		goto err_fw;
105 	}
106 
107 	ret = xhci_register(dev, ctx->hcd, hcor);
108 	if (ret) {
109 		dev_err(dev, "Failed to register xHCI\n");
110 		goto err_fw;
111 	}
112 
113 	return 0;
114 
115 err_fw:
116 	clk_disable(&plat->clk);
117 err_clk:
118 	clk_free(&plat->clk);
119 	return ret;
120 }
121 
xhci_rcar_deregister(struct udevice * dev)122 static int xhci_rcar_deregister(struct udevice *dev)
123 {
124 	int ret;
125 	struct rcar_xhci_plat *plat = dev_get_plat(dev);
126 
127 	ret = xhci_deregister(dev);
128 
129 	clk_disable(&plat->clk);
130 	clk_free(&plat->clk);
131 
132 	return ret;
133 }
134 
xhci_rcar_of_to_plat(struct udevice * dev)135 static int xhci_rcar_of_to_plat(struct udevice *dev)
136 {
137 	struct rcar_xhci_plat *plat = dev_get_plat(dev);
138 
139 	plat->hcd_base = dev_read_addr(dev);
140 	if (plat->hcd_base == FDT_ADDR_T_NONE) {
141 		debug("Can't get the XHCI register base address\n");
142 		return -ENXIO;
143 	}
144 
145 	return 0;
146 }
147 
148 static const struct udevice_id xhci_rcar_ids[] = {
149 	{ .compatible = "renesas,rcar-gen3-xhci" },
150 	{ .compatible = "renesas,xhci-r8a7795" },
151 	{ .compatible = "renesas,xhci-r8a7796" },
152 	{ .compatible = "renesas,xhci-r8a77965" },
153 	{ }
154 };
155 
156 U_BOOT_DRIVER(usb_xhci) = {
157 	.name		= "xhci_rcar",
158 	.id		= UCLASS_USB,
159 	.probe		= xhci_rcar_probe,
160 	.remove		= xhci_rcar_deregister,
161 	.ops		= &xhci_usb_ops,
162 	.of_match	= xhci_rcar_ids,
163 	.of_to_plat = xhci_rcar_of_to_plat,
164 	.plat_auto	= sizeof(struct rcar_xhci_plat),
165 	.priv_auto	= sizeof(struct rcar_xhci),
166 	.flags		= DM_FLAG_ALLOC_PRIV_DMA,
167 };
168
